    Default Dragon Age own's DVD drive in Win7

    I just noticed, it may have done it all along, but once I play Dragon Age in Win 7 & exit the game properly.
    Remove the Dragon Age DVD & put a movie DVD in the drive, Explorer & DVD Shrink still see Dragon Age. Refreshing explorer doesn't help.
    The only way to use the DVD Drive is to reboot.
    I checked the Registry for upper & lower filters, but none are there.
